Juan Mata completes move to Chelsea
Juan Mata has completed his move to Chelsea from Spanish club Valencia for a reported £23.5m.
Mata has signed a five-year contract and is available for Saturday's game against Norwich.
"Valencia was a big club anyway but I have left to join a bigger club," the 23-year-old winger said. "It is all about the opportunity to win trophies and I have that here."
The Spaniard said Blues boss Andre Villas-Boas convinced him to move.
"He said he wanted Chelsea this season to play more attacking football, and that I would be a big part of that," added Mata.
"Villas-Boas is someone who won almost everything last year [the former Porto boss won the Portuguese league, Europa League and two domestic cups last season] and we are both here with the idea of winning lots this season."
